Typical Faults


Usual dishwasher mistakes could vary from minor to significant ones. Depending on the degree, you will either require the services of expert plumbers to take care of or replace it.
A few of the most typical mistakes include:

Dripping Dishwashing machine


This is possibly the most day-to-day dishwasher issue, and also fortunately is that it is simple to identify. Leaks take place due to a number of reasons, as well as the leakages can ruin your kitchen. Typical root causes of dishwasher leaks include;
  • Incorrect pipeline link: If the pipelines at the back of your device are not safely taken care of or if they are broken, it can trigger leakages.

  • Improper meal piling: Always ensure that you do not overstack the tray which you organize the dishes properly

  • Way too much detergent: Putting sufficient cleaning agent might likewise create a leakage. Make certain that you place simply enough for your dishes and not more.

  • Rust: It could likewise be a result of some rust or corrosion of your machine. In this instance, it is far better to change the dishwasher.

  • Door Seals: Check if the door seals are still undamaged as well as safely attached. If the seals are not ready, maybe a significant reason for leaks.

  • Bad-Smelling Dishwashing machine


    This is one more typical dish washer trouble, and also it is mainly caused by food debris or grease lingering in the device. In this case, look for these particles, take them out and do the dishes without any dishes inside the machine. Wash the filter extensively. That will certainly aid do away with the negative odor. Make sure that you eliminate every food bit from your meals before transferring it to the device in the future.

    Inability to Drain


    Sometimes you may notice a huge quantity of water left in your bathtub after a laundry. That is most likely a drain problem. You can either check the drainpipe tube for problems or obstructions. When unsure, get in touch with a professional to have it examined as well as taken care of.

    Does not clean properly


    If your recipes as well as cutleries come out of the dishwasher and also still look filthy or unclean, your spray arms may be a problem. In many cases, the spray arms can obtain blocked, and it will call for a fast clean or a replacement to function successfully again.

    7 Common Dishwasher Problems (and How to Fix Them)


    Dirty, smelly, possibly covered in cheese. Is there anything more frustrating than opening the dishwasher only to find the dirty dishes are still there?! I mean, the main reason you buy a dishwasher is so you don’t have to deal with dirty dishes. C’mon dishwasher, you had one job.



    A little maintenance goes a long way when it comes to appliances, but the truth is nothing lasts forever (sadly). That doesn’t mean it’s hopeless, though. With a handful of simple tricks, you can fix some of the most common dishwasher problems and bring that sparkle back into your dishwasher and back into your life.


    My Dishes Are Still Dirty


    This is at the top of a list for a reason. Dirty dishes are common and frustrating. Easy fixes first; check if your dishwasher has a manual filter and make sure that it’s clean and clear of debris. Then, as you load your dishwasher, make sure that the spray arms can rotate freely, spraying water throughout the drum. If they’re blocked or obstructed, you won’t be getting optimal cleaning performance. If the problem continues, check if your spray arms are clean and moving freely as grease and food particles can prevent them from spinning.



    Also, stop pre-rinsing your dishes! Modern dishwashers use sensors to determine the soil level of the dishes. If you rinse them off too much, your dishwasher may select a shorter cycle than is necessary. Modern detergents also use enzymes that activate when they come in contact with food particles. If you remove the particles, your detergent will be less effective too.


    My Dishes Aren’t Drying


    The easiest fixes here are to add Rinse Aid to your dishwasher when you start the load to assist drying, and to make sure you don’t stack plastic against plastic or other hard to dry materials. It’s also a good idea to open the dishwasher door when the cycle is complete to release steam and prevent condensation from settling on your dishes (some higher-end machines even open automatically). If your dishwasher has a heating element, you may have to check if it is working properly. Check also the fan if your dishwasher has a stainless steel tub that uses blown radiant heat to dry.


    My Dishwasher Smells Bad


    If your dishwasher smells bad, make sure your filter and screens are cleaned of any grime and food residue. Check the spray arms and gasket on the door to make sure there’s no grease or food waste there as well. If you’ve done that, then it may just be time to sanitize the drum. Place a small bowl with vinegar in the upper basket of your empty dishwasher and run the sanitize cycle (or the hottest cycle you’ve got) to blast away bad odours.


    My Dishwasher Won’t Start


    If your dishwasher won’t start there’s often an electrical problem, and if you’re lucky that means there’s a very easy fix. Ask yourself, have I tried turning it off and on? If not, then do that. If it’s still not working, try unplugging and re-plugging in the machine and double-check your breaker to make sure power is feeding the unit. If it’s a mechanical problem, then it may be that your door isn’t latching properly and a simple realignment will get things sorted out.


    My Dishwasher Won’t Fill


    If possible, check your intake valves and make sure that the screen is clear and that there’s no blockage obstructing water flow. If that’s not it, then the float and/or float switch located at the bottom of the drum could be the problem. Make sure that the electrical connections are intact and that the mechanism hasn’t been damaged or blocked in any way.
